The Ombudsman is an independent, impartial officer of the Legislature that resolves and investigates complaints about Ontario government organizations, broader public sector bodies, including municipalities, universities and school boards, child protection services, and compliance with the French Language Services Act.


The Ombudsman recommends solutions to individual and systemic administrative problems, and promotes fairness, accountability and transparency in the public sector as well as respect for French language service rights and the rights of children and youth.


What can I expect to do in this role?: This opportunity will appeal to Investigators who are keen to be part of a world-renowned office with a proven record of improving the fairness, accountability and transparency of government and public services. Investigators at Ombudsman Ontario are responsible for both leading and working as a team on a diverse range of administrative fairness and maladministration issues.


As an investigator, you will be accountable for investigations from inception to completion, which includes identifying fairness issues; interviewing members of the public, public sector officials, and witnesses; gathering and analyzing information; and writing clear, comprehensive, and persuasive reports.

Much of the work also includes using alternate dispute resolution mechanisms and responding to members of the public experiencing personal crisis.

Your work will play a crucial role in the development of the Ombudsman's recommendations to improve the fairness, transparency and accountability of governance.

Responsibilities:

  • Reviewing complaint files and gathering necessary information to identify issues for resolution and/or investigation
  • Drafting investigation plans involving both individual and systemic issues with a focus on detailed factfinding, fairness, timelines and attention to detail
  • Interviewing witnesses, gathering and analyzing information, and writing clear, concise and comprehensive reports
  • Writing and/or assisting in the preparation of highprofile special investigation reports including findings, analysis and recommendations
  • Assessing potential for early resolution of cases and taking appropriate steps to facilitate resolution
  • Other duties related to investigations could be required.

Knowledge and experience:

  • University degree (in a field such as law, psychology, political science, public administration, social work, criminal justice)
  • Minimum three years of experience responding to or investigating complaints about government services or programs
  • Experience providing service to members of the public, including underserved and marginalized populations
  • Proven ability to interview members of the public and public sector officials at all organizational levels
  • Working knowledge of provincial government organizations, boards and agencies, as well as knowledge of the Ombudsman Act, Ombudsman Ontario jurisdiction, and the provincial government and its structures
  • Demonstrated experience preparing investigation reports dealing with individual and systemic issues
  • Experience generating evidencebased and practical solutions to address complaints and systemic issues
  • Experience persuading parties to adopt a course of action
  • Proficiency in oral and written communication in English is required; proficiency in oral and written communication in French is an asset.

Required skills and Competencies:

  • Strong analytical skills and the ability to impartially and objectively assess relevant evidence
  • Exceptional writing skills
  • Ability to work effectively in a teambased environment, and be open to consultation and collaboration in determining appropriate solutions for complaints and inquiries
  • Strong interpersonal skills, including the ability to deal with emotionally charged situations and vulnerable complainants
  • Excellent organizational, administrative and time management skills to manage caseloads
  • Ability to work independently with minimum supervision.
